How AI Overviews Are Changing Local Search — And What Small Businesses Must Do Now

Hand using stylus beside laptop and tablet, with a red map pin storefront icon and star ratings overlaying the screen.

Someone searches for "best plumber near me." A year ago, they scrolled through a list of websites, clicked a few, and made their choice. Today, Google often answers the question right at the top of the page—no clicking required. That box of AI-generated text is called an AI Overview, and it's quietly reshaping how local customers find businesses like yours.


For small and mid-sized businesses, this shift is both a challenge and an opportunity. The companies that adapt early will stay visible and keep winning customers. Those that ignore it risk fading into the background. Let's walk through what's actually happening, why it matters for your bottom line, and the practical steps you can take right now.


What AI Overviews Actually Are


AI Overviews are the summarized answers Google generates at the top of many search results. Instead of just listing links, Google reads across multiple sources, pulls together the most relevant information, and presents a tidy answer in plain language.


For broad questions, this feels helpful. But for local searches—where customers are looking for a service, a shop, or a provider nearby—it changes the path to your door. The customer may get their answer without ever clicking through to a website. And that's a big deal when your website is often the first real introduction to your business.


The numbers tell the story. Around 43% of local searches now trigger AI Overviews or AI-generated summaries. Alongside that, businesses are seeing roughly a 31% drop in clicks to individual listings. Fewer clicks doesn't have to mean fewer customers—but only if you adjust your strategy to stay visible inside this new search experience.


Why This Matters for Your Local Business


Here's the part worth paying close attention to. When Google answers a question directly, the businesses it pulls information from get the visibility. Everyone else gets skipped.


That means showing up is no longer just about ranking high on a list of links. It's about being the trusted source that Google chooses to feature. If your business information is accurate, consistent, and rich with helpful detail, you have a far better chance of being included in that AI summary—and in the map results customers still rely on.


The flip side is real too. If your online presence is thin, outdated, or inconsistent across platforms, you become easy to overlook. Customers won't see a problem; they'll simply choose the business that does appear. The cost of staying still is invisibility, and that's a cost no growing business can afford.


The Trust Signals AI Pays Attention To


AI Overviews and local rankings both lean heavily on signals that prove your business is legitimate, active, and trustworthy. Think of these as the proof points that tell Google you deserve to be featured.


A few signals carry real weight:


  • Consistency across every platform, so your name, address, phone number, and hours match wherever they appear.

  • Fresh activity, including recent reviews, posts, and updates that show your business is alive and engaged.

  • Relevance, meaning your content clearly answers the questions local customers are actually asking.

  • Authority, built through positive reviews, quality content, and a steady online reputation.


The encouraging truth is that these signals are within your control. With the right approach, you can strengthen each one and give Google every reason to put your business front and center.


What Small Businesses Must Do Now


Adapting doesn't require a massive budget or a complete overhaul. It requires focus on the moves that matter most. Here are the actions that will keep you visible as AI reshapes local search.


1. Optimize Your Google Business Profile

Your Google Business Profile is often the single most important asset for local visibility. Make sure every field is complete and accurate—hours, services, categories, photos, and contact details. Post updates regularly, answer questions, and keep your information current. A fully optimized profile is one of the strongest ways to earn a spot in local results and AI summaries.


2. Add Structured Data to Your Website

Structured data is code that helps search engines understand exactly what your business offers. It labels your services, location, reviews, and hours in a language Google reads easily. When your site speaks clearly to search engines, you make it far simpler for AI to pull and feature your information accurately.


3. Build Genuinely Helpful Local Content

Create content that answers the real questions your customers ask. Service pages, location pages, and helpful articles all give Google more to work with—and more reasons to feature you. The goal isn't to stuff in keywords. It's to be genuinely useful, because useful content is exactly what AI Overviews are built to surface.


4. Grow and Manage Your Reviews

Reviews remain one of the most powerful trust signals available. A steady stream of recent, positive reviews tells both customers and search engines that your business is reliable and active. Respond to every review promptly and professionally. This consistent engagement strengthens your reputation and reinforces the trust signals AI relies on.


5. Keep Your Information Consistent Everywhere

Inconsistent details confuse both customers and search engines. Audit your listings across directories, social platforms, and review sites to make sure everything matches. Clean, consistent information builds the credibility that helps you stand out in an AI-driven search world.
